India, Sept. 16 -- Thales and IndiGo, India's largest airline, have signed a strategic maintenance contract for the airline's current fleet of 430 Airbus A320 aircraft and future order of over 800 A32X aircraft.As part of this 11-year contract, Thales will provide IndiGo with expert repair services for avionics components, coupled with Thales's 'Avionics-By-The-Hour' (ABTH) programme - a comprehensive spares management solution that ensures the availability of critical components to minimise aircraft downtime.
